談談我對sku的理解(3)----頁面效果

前面介紹了我理解的sku概念和表設計,那麼最後看一下做好後的效果頁面。
後臺發佈。



sku發佈的頁面大概是這樣:

                          屬性值                       屬性值
屬性  顏色            紅色                          白色                + -                 刪除  添加
屬性  內存            16g                           32g                + -                 刪除  添加





點擊+-來增加刪除 屬性值,點擊刪除 添加按鈕用來增加刪除屬性行








前臺效果


195046nhix3nsqxbnuubin.png                195050m4uyymm3fzqwwuu8.png                195054kbp3jsvdfskqjivz.png 


說個插曲
點擊了所有屬性,會再計算價格庫存,所以我們設計了一張表來儲存skuid+價格+庫存,然後點擊一個屬性自動去判斷是否有庫存等。但是發現每點擊一次去查詢實在太慢了,如果屬性很多,複雜度就幾何式增長。
我們的解決辦法是,儘量到最後一個屬性前再來校驗,而且不用每點擊一次就去查數據庫。是進入頁面的時候就把所有的sku組合(包括sku內部組合的可能比如  白色:16g 和 16g:白色 )對應的價格和庫存全部帶到頁面上。然後通過js來校驗查詢,速度達到需要的要求。

轉發請標明原地址http://techfoxbbs.com/thread-21656-1-1.html 歡迎大家關注我們的公衆微信   TechfoxBBS   


發表評論
所有評論
還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.
相關文章